Holy Cross Airport
Remote Alaskan village gateway on the Yukon River.
- ›Holy Cross has no road access to the Alaska highway system, making the airport essential for all outside travel.
- ›The runway is gravel-surfaced and suitable for small commuter and bush aircraft.
- ›The airport serves a village population of fewer than 250 residents.
- ›Emergency medical evacuation flights represent a critical function of the airport.
- ›The airport is located in the Yukon-Kuskokwim Delta region of interior Alaska.

Holy Cross Airport is a state-owned public-use airport located one mile (1.6 km) south of the central business district of Holy Cross, a city in the Yukon-Koyukuk Census Area of the U.S. state of Alaska.
